"Discover the captivating world of Bahram Gur, a legendary hero from the Quintet and Seven Portraits of Nizami. Witness Bahram's encounters in various palaces: Fridays in the White Palace, Folio 235 (A.H. 931 / A.D); Sundays in the Yellow Palace, Folio 213; Thursdays in the Sandal Palace, Folio 230; and Mondays in the Green Palace, Folio [unknown]. Bahram's romantic liaisons include a Greek Princess in the Yellow Pavilion and an Indian Princess in the Dark Palace, Folio 23v (ca. 1430). Bahram's adventures extend beyond palace walls, as seen in Folio 10r from the Haft Paikar (Seven Portraits) of Nizami, where he is depicted on the chase. In the Dark Palace on Saturday, Folio 207, Bahram faces a braggart who meets a tragic end in a well, as told in the tale "How a Braggart was Drowned in a Well." On Wednesdays, Bahram resides in the Turquoise Palace, as depicted in Folio 216 from the Khamsa. This collection of folios, created between A.H. 931 and ca. 1430, offers a glimpse into the rich tapestry of Bahram Gur's life and adventures."
